/*****************************************************************************/
/*** bcast_client ***/
/*** ***/
/*** Demonstrate the mechanics and behavior of a broadcast sender and ***/
/*** receiver. ***/
/*****************************************************************************/
#include <stdio.h>
#include <errno.h>
#include <malloc.h>
#include <sys/socket.h>
#include <resolv.h>
#include <arpa/inet.h>
#include <stdarg.h>
#include <sched.h>
#include <sys/signal.h>
#define DEFAULT_PORT 9999
/*---------------------------------------------------------------------------*/
/* panic - catch error and die. */
/*---------------------------------------------------------------------------*/
void panic(char* msg, ...)
{ va_list ap;
va_start(ap, msg);
vprintf(msg, ap);
perror("errno=");
va_end(ap);
abort();
}
/*---------------------------------------------------------------------------*/
/* strtrim - remove trailing spaces. */
/*---------------------------------------------------------------------------*/
char* strtrim(char *str)
{ char *tail;
tail = str+strlen(str)-1;
while ( tail > str && *tail <= ' ' )
*tail-- = 0;
return str;
}
/*---------------------------------------------------------------------------*/
/* Receiver - catch broadcast messages and display them with sender's addr. */
/*---------------------------------------------------------------------------*/
int Receiver(int sd)
{ char buffer[1024];
struct sockaddr_in addr;
do
{ int len = sizeof(addr);
if ( recvfrom(sd, buffer, sizeof(buffer), 0, (struct sockaddr*)&addr, &len) > 0 )
printf("Got %s:%d \"%s\"\n", inet_ntoa(addr.sin_addr), ntohs(addr.sin_port), buffer);
else
perror("recvfrom");
}
while ( strcmp(buffer, "bye\n") != 0 );
fprintf(stderr, "child exiting\n");
exit(0);
}
/*---------------------------------------------------------------------------*/
/* main - Create socket, enable broadcasting, fork child, begin sending. */
/*---------------------------------------------------------------------------*/
int main(int count, char *strings[])
{ const int on=1;
int sd, port;
struct sockaddr_in addr;
char buffer[1024];
/*---Get parameters---*/
if ( count < 3 || count > 4)
{
printf("usage: %s [<listening-port>] <dest-addr> <dest-port>\n", strings[0]);
return 0;
}
if ( count == 4 )
{
port = atoi(strings[1]);
strings++;
}
else
port = DEFAULT_PORT;
/*---Create and configure socket---*/
sd = socket(PF_INET, SOCK_DGRAM, 0);
if ( sd < 0 )
panic("socket failed");
if ( setsockopt(sd, SOL_SOCKET, SO_BROADCAST, &on, sizeof(on)) != 0 )
panic("set broadcast failed");
bzero(&addr, sizeof(addr));
addr.sin_family = AF_INET;
addr.sin_port = htons(port);
if ( inet_aton("128.1.1.1", &addr.sin_addr) == 0 )
panic("inet_aton failed (%s)", strings[1]);
if ( bind(sd, (struct sockaddr*)&addr, sizeof(addr)) != 0 )
panic("bind failed");
addr.sin_port = htons(atoi(strings[2]));
if ( inet_aton(strings[1], &addr.sin_addr) == 0 )
panic("inet_aton failed (%s)", strings[1]);
/*---Create child---*/
if ( fork() )
Receiver(sd);
else
shutdown(sd, 0); /* close the input channel */
/*---Begin broadcast---*/
do
{
fgets(buffer, sizeof(buffer), stdin);
strtrim(buffer);
if ( sendto(sd, buffer, strlen(buffer)+1, 0, (struct sockaddr*)&addr, sizeof(addr)) < 0 )
perror("sendto");
}
while ( strcmp(buffer, "bye") != 0 );
/*---Wait for child termination & cleanup---*/
wait(0);
close(sd);
return 0;
}
